Vapor Pressure Data: Heptaldehyde (enanthaldehyde)

285.15 to 428.15

Tabulated vapor pressure vs temperature for ~2800 pure compounds (inorganic and organic). Each row gives vapor pressure in Pa at a specific temperature in Kelvin. Covers cryogenic to high-boiling-point ranges. Includes water (ice, supercooled, and liquid phases), gases, organics, metals, and inorganic salts.

Chemical Engineeringcompound name: Heptaldehyde (enanthaldehyde)10 rows
compound nametemperature Kdata source tableformulavapor pressure Pa (Pa)
Heptaldehyde (enanthaldehyde)285.15Table 2-10C7H14O133.322
Heptaldehyde (enanthaldehyde)305.85Table 2-10C7H14O666.61
Heptaldehyde (enanthaldehyde)316.15Table 2-10C7H14O1,333.22
Heptaldehyde (enanthaldehyde)327.15Table 2-10C7H14O2,666.44
Heptaldehyde (enanthaldehyde)339.45Table 2-10C7H14O5,332.88
Heptaldehyde (enanthaldehyde)347.15Table 2-10C7H14O7,999.32
Heptaldehyde (enanthaldehyde)357.15Table 2-10C7H14O13,332.2
Heptaldehyde (enanthaldehyde)375.15Table 2-10C7H14O26,664.4
Heptaldehyde (enanthaldehyde)398.65Table 2-10C7H14O53,328.8
Heptaldehyde (enanthaldehyde)428.15Table 2-10C7H14O101,324.72
